As you can see from the link it's not Kickstarter, it's a system called Eppela (Italian? Crowdfunding site) . You have to sign up with a Credit Card which registers with a nominal transaction. As I understand it you pay on your credit card and if the project funds the creator get the money, if the project fails to fund the money is re-credited to the card by the intermediary (Mangopay).
